Output 358165699ee5a850eb215d0087b2b1f2e5f5459613d215d3dcd61d1388c0769c:1

value
10883000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d0a47e39bebd2a454c6e614c67f3324506adb9 OP_EQUAL
address
3MjHrHxbxkjPF9ofKz7uKAvz8QsfHNCHhD
transaction
358165699ee5a850eb215d0087b2b1f2e5f5459613d215d3dcd61d1388c0769c
spent
true